“Glass Forest” (blown glass)

At Chihuly Garden and Glass, Seattle. My first frame of the visit.

We visited a Chihuly installation at the Missouri Botanical Garden in St. Louis many years ago, so we knew what Chihuly was about, but the rooms and gardens here still held many "Wow!" moments for us.

For those not familiar with Dale Chihuly's work, this is all blown glass.
